
Duvel Belgian Beer
The Flemish word for Devil, this golden beer is quite strong. First brewed in the 1920s, it’s made from Scottish yeast, Czechoslovakian hops, French barley and local Flemish water as well as involving four temperature changes, three fermentations and two months of maturing.
